Material Specialist / Material Handler

Location:

Aberdeen - Bridge of Don

Contract Length: 6 months

Rate: £14 - £15 per hour

We are currently recruiting for an experienced Material Specialist / Material Handler to support warehouse and materials operations at a large industrial site in Aberdeen. This is a hands‑on role within a fast‑paced environment, ideal for candidates with strong warehouse experience and valid forklift certifications.

The Role

The successful candidate will play a key role in ensuring the safe, accurate movement, storage and documentation of materials to support ongoing operations. You will be working closely with warehouse and operations teams to maintain high standards of safety, organisation and inventory control.

Key Responsibilities
  • Safely operate forklifts and material‑handling equipment (B1 & B2 essential)
  • Accurately move, store and issue materials in line with work orders and procedures
  • Read and interpret written instructions, pick lists and operational documentation
  • Prepare clear and accurate reports relating to inventory and material movements
  • Process shipping and receiving documentation in line with internal procedures
  • Maintain awareness of site layout, storage locations and material flows
  • Carry out basic inventory calculations to ensure stock accuracy
  • Adhere strictly to all health, safety and site procedures at all times
Requirements
  • Valid Forklift B1 & B2 licences (mandatory)
  • Minimum 2+ years' experience in an industrial warehouse or materials role
  • Ability to work efficiently in a fast‑paced, safety‑critical environment
  • Strong communication skills with the ability to complete written documentation
  • Willingness to complete and maintain all required certifications and site training
Additional Information
  • Contract role: 6 months
  • Site‑based position in Aberdeen (Bridge of Don)
  • Immediate or short‑notice starters preferred
